Output 5be403364b59ed7458dcfbde614bce9af331e15a032fcecff5533890d195f051:1

value
659907
script pubkey
OP_0 OP_PUSHBYTES_20 7ec55089454686363be2da6e2e989a2f08acfc72
address
bc1q0mz4pz29g6rrvwlzmfhzaxy69uy2elrj3ctzn5
transaction
5be403364b59ed7458dcfbde614bce9af331e15a032fcecff5533890d195f051
confirmations
168308
spent
true